Romes187 11/18/19 3:12:53 PM #165 | DuranOfForcena posted... seems pretty intriguing, but i think it can stand to be expanded on a bit. you're well under the suggested wordcount range for queries, so you have quite a bit of leeway. in fact, i think if it's too short then agents might get the impression that you haven't put enough thought or detail into it. dunno really, probably depends on the agent, but either way, i would say the personal stakes for the main character and why he gets involved in this adventure could be imparted a bit more clearly. and maybe more detail about what the cult's nefarious plans are, and what might happen if the protagonist doesn't stop them. Thx for feedback. There are a lot of conflicting ideas about how to write a query and I was trying to showcase my writing style. As a thriller, its short, quick paced, and to the point. But motivation should be something to add in. Looking at your protoquery, it is definitely more wordy than mine, but that might be your writing style and its probably good to try and match with the manuscript for obvious reasons. Give them a taste of whats to come. I do also have a synopsis which is gonna be a play by play of the entire story, spoilers and all. I figured the natural progression was query -> if interested, sample chapters --> if still interested, read synopsis to make sure payoff is worth it -> request for full but every agent has their own ways im sure |

Romes187 11/13/19 2:32:25 PM #134 | spanky1 posted... What I've found, I think, is that actual readers of an actual full book are quite patient, and know that novels sometimes take some time to get going. The people who tend to be brutally merciless with their attention spans are the ones reading those endless supplies of chapter 1s over on the many reddit writing subs. I feel like that's a huge thing that sits in their heads when in critique mode. True, and even truer in genre fiction where some setup may be an expectation (fantasy). I think I'm speaking more towards commercial fiction where you need to convince a lit agent (who does read through endless supplies of chapter 1s) to represent you. And also, I guess I'm attempting to write with more broad appeal, knowing I wont satisfy the heavy genre readers, but maybe someone who wants a bubble gum book to read on a plane haha. |
